Battery Technology: Powering Your Fake Camera
Choosing the right battery technology is paramount for a realistic-looking, long-lasting imitation security camera setup. Lithium-ion batteries are a popular choice due to their high energy density and ability to withstand numerous charge cycles. This ensures your fake camera can operate smoothly for extended periods without frequent replacements. Look for batteries with sufficient capacity to match the intended usage; for instance, a motion-activated camera might require a higher capacity battery to handle sudden bursts of activity.
Consider using rechargeable batteries to reduce costs and environmental impact. Many modern battery packs come with built-in charging capabilities, allowing you to top up the fake camera’s power levels wirelessly or via USB. This convenience ensures your security setup remains operational, providing peace of mind without constant monitoring of battery levels.

Placement Strategies: Maximizing Deterrent Effect
Placement is key when utilizing battery-powered fake security camera setups to deter potential criminals. Strategically positioning these devices can significantly enhance their deterrent effect and contribute to a safer environment. For optimal results, consider installing them in highly visible areas where they can be easily spotted by passersby or would-be intruders. This could include placing them on walls near entry points, such as front doors or windows, ensuring they are visible from the street or common areas.
Additionally, mounting these fake cameras at eye level or slightly elevated positions can make them more intimidating, as it is harder for criminals to avoid their line of sight. Natural placement techniques, like disguising them as real security equipment or integrating them into existing fixtures, can further increase their effectiveness and reduce the likelihood of removal or tampering.
